COVID-19 infections have surged in Connecticut, pushing the state to claim one of the highest rates of new cases in the country this week, data shows. The number of new cases per person over the previous seven days in Connecticut was the highest in the country on Monday and the second highest on both Tuesday and Wednesday, according to data The New York Times collects from state and local health agencies.
